Auto-Merge pull request #2586 from octo/issue/2583
authorcollectd bot <32910397+collectd-bot@users.noreply.github.com>
Thu, 30 Nov 2017 09:09:13 +0000 (10:09 +0100)
committerGitHub <noreply@github.com>
Thu, 30 Nov 2017 09:09:13 +0000 (10:09 +0100)
Automatically merged due to "Automerge" label

src/virt.c

index ca6e831..174db2f 100644 (file)
@@ -444,12 +444,10 @@ static void init_block_info(struct lv_block_info *binfo) {
 #ifdef HAVE_BLOCK_STATS_FLAGS
 
 #define GET_BLOCK_INFO_VALUE(NAME, FIELD)                                      \
-  do {                                                                         \
-    if (!strcmp(param[i].field, NAME)) {                                       \
-      binfo->FIELD = param[i].value.l;                                         \
-      continue;                                                                \
-    }                                                                          \
-  } while (0)
+  if (!strcmp(param[i].field, NAME)) {                                         \
+    binfo->FIELD = param[i].value.l;                                           \
+    continue;                                                                  \
+  }
 
 static int get_block_info(struct lv_block_info *binfo,
                           virTypedParameterPtr param, int nparams) {